The church of the venerable Athanasius of Athos is built of stone and has three altars. The main, cold altar is dedicated to the venerable Athanasius of Athos. In the warm chapels, the altars are: on the right, in honor of Saint Great Martyr Demetrius of Thessalonica, and on the left, in honor of Saint Martyr Paraskeva. The church was erected in 1827 with funds from the parishioners. The village, founded in 1776, became the center of the parish that unites 10 settlements in the same year. Among the particularly revered icons are the icon of the venerable Athanasius of Athos and the icon of the Kazan Mother of God. The church owns 69 desyatins and 1080 square fathoms of land. There are church houses for the priest and the psalmist. The church capital amounts to 1267 rubles in notes. The village is located on a hill by the Sivoza River and has a primary school. The clergy consists of a priest and a psalmist, with the parish capital in securities amounting to 5407 rubles.
